A. I believe we are all capable of greatness. Greatness may mean different things to you and I, but for me it requires a certain set of principles to adhere to in ones life.
1
A. Greatness requires effort. Greatness requires thought. Greatness is tough. Greatness requires constantly staying out of your comfort zone and making it your home. What is the best part of about greatness? The best part is that we can give it whatever definition we want
2
B. I believe to be great you must stay hungry. Before I embarked on my journey back to college I had a sweet job in the Marine Corps taking pictures and writing news stories. I was well on my way to getting promoted to Sergeant, I had the respect of my superiors and I had my choice of my next duty station. There was only one problem; I wanted more. I believe we should not choose comfort over opportunity.
3
C. In this world we live in, where conformity is celebrated and differing opinions are shunned, I believe we should question everything. Greatness involves making your own choices. It involves coming to your own conclusions and not just accepting what is told to you.
4
D. I believe that to be great one must be humble. Learn as much as you can from anyone and everyone who will teach you and never feel like something is beneath you. Greatness involves sucking up your pride and accepting the fact that you don’t know everything. It means accepting the fact that sometimes you really do have to work from the bottom and prove your worth along with your “mad skills.”
5
E. I believe that to be great is to be annoying. Never take no for an answer. Never let someone make you feel dumb for asking too many questions. If there is nothing they can do ask for their manager, if they still can’t do anything about it go higher. You will annoy the right person eventually and get exactly what you want, and then some.
6
A. I believe that the only thing holding us back is ourselves. I believe that we can be whomever we want to be if we really try. We all capable of being great, regardless of our past. If we respect ourselves, others, and constantly seek self-improvement, I believe that there is nothing we can’t accomplish during our time here on this amazing world.
